I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

EDI, CMS, Outils, Scripts et API PHP Discussion :

[eZ Publish]Insertion d'une page


Sujet :

EDI, CMS, Outils, Scripts et API PHP

  1. #1
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Février 2007
    Messages
    2
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Février 2007
    Messages : 2
    Points : 1
    Points
    1
    Par défaut [eZ Publish]Insertion d'une page
    Bonjour,

    Je dois récupérer des information depuis EZpublish pour les envoyer vers un site asp.
    Pour celà, j'ai créé un fromulaire pointant vers ma page asp.

    le problème est que ce formulaire fait appel à des pages ezpublish (register.php) et que les includes renseignés dans cette page ne sont pas trouvés
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    Warning: main(lib/ezutils/classes/ezhttptool.php): failed to open stream: No such file or directory in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 36
     
    Warning: main(): Failed opening 'lib/ezutils/classes/ezhttptool.php' for inclusion (include_path='.;C:/Program Files/EasyPHP1-8\php\pear\') in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 36
     
    Warning: main(kernel/classes/datatypes/ezuser/ezuser.php): failed to open stream: No such file or directory in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 37
     
    Warning: main(): Failed opening 'kernel/classes/datatypes/ezuser/ezuser.php' for inclusion (include_path='.;C:/Program Files/EasyPHP1-8\php\pear\') in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 37
     
    Warning: main(lib/ezutils/classes/ezmail.php): failed to open stream: No such file or directory in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 38
     
    Warning: main(): Failed opening 'lib/ezutils/classes/ezmail.php' for inclusion (include_path='.;C:/Program Files/EasyPHP1-8\php\pear\') in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 38
     
    Warning: main(kernel/classes/ezcontentclassattribute.php): failed to open stream: No such file or directory in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 39
     
    Warning: main(): Failed opening 'kernel/classes/ezcontentclassattribute.php' for inclusion (include_path='.;C:/Program Files/EasyPHP1-8\php\pear\') in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 39
     
    Warning: main(kernel/classes/ezcontentclass.php): failed to open stream: No such file or directory in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 40
     
    Warning: main(): Failed opening 'kernel/classes/ezcontentclass.php' for inclusion (include_path='.;C:/Program Files/EasyPHP1-8\php\pear\') in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 40
     
    Fatal error: Undefined class name 'ezhttptool' in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 42

  2. #2
    Membre confirmé Avatar de goodpz
    Profil pro
    Inscrit en
    Février 2007
    Messages
    475
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2007
    Messages : 475
    Points : 514
    Points
    514
    Par défaut
    Suffit de faire en sorte que les include() fonctionnent, non ?

    Apparemment, il faut que le répertoire de EZpublish qui contient les répertoires kernel et lib soit dans l'include_path

    Essai ce genre de chose en adaptant avec le bon path: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    set_include_path('C:/chemin/vers/EZpublish/' . PATH_SEPARATOR . get_include_path());

  3. #3
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Février 2007
    Messages
    2
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Février 2007
    Messages : 2
    Points : 1
    Points
    1
    Par défaut
    Celà ne fonctionne toujours pas. Et de plus, celà ralenti très fortement le temps de chargement de la page.

    J'obtiens maintenant cette erreur (au vu des warnings, EZpublish ne semble pas bien débuggé... ):

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    Warning: Invalid argument supplied for foreach() in C:\Program Files\EasyPHP1-8\www\ezpublish\lib\ezutils\classes\ezextension.php on line 140
     
    Warning: array_keys(): The first argument should be an array in C:\Program Files\EasyPHP1-8\www\ezpublish\kernel\classes\ezcontenttranslation.php on line 148
     
    Warning: Invalid argument supplied for foreach() in C:\Program Files\EasyPHP1-8\www\ezpublish\kernel\classes\ezcontenttranslation.php on line 148
     
    Fatal error: Call to a member function on a non-object in c:\program files\easyphp1-8\www\ezpublish\kernel\user\register.php on line 96

Discussions similaires

  1. Insertion d'une page cms dans un site non cms
    Par jonusbaum d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 1
    Dernier message: 10/04/2007, 15h16
  2. [debutant] requete "insert" dans une page jsp
    Par el_bassir dans le forum JDBC
    Réponses: 2
    Dernier message: 31/08/2006, 18h13
  3. insertion d'une page web
    Par lazzeroni dans le forum Interfaces Graphiques en Java
    Réponses: 5
    Dernier message: 02/05/2006, 10h38
  4. probléme d'insert dans une page asp !
    Par tomtom25 dans le forum ASP
    Réponses: 5
    Dernier message: 31/03/2005, 16h04
  5. [JEditorPane] Insertion d'une page html
    Par flzox dans le forum Composants
    Réponses: 8
    Dernier message: 30/08/2004, 23h46

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o